Output 0583dda1f0a9d556f7ae0572b9f5b289fd37467de54cbe154d7bf3db1fad898a:0

value
998392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a0d3154e702a6cb2a23887251caef422888bf7 OP_EQUAL
address
3CWGKTvLoaoAjvWj1trsk4cdTPExf29ezj
transaction
0583dda1f0a9d556f7ae0572b9f5b289fd37467de54cbe154d7bf3db1fad898a
confirmations
383696
spent
true